		<description><![CDATA[Renter’s insurance is not required by law in California.  I doubt that it is required in any state.  That it is not required doesn’t make it any less important.  As a tenant you have legal liability for everything that takes place at the rented place.  If someone is injured, you can be sued.  Your personal property is not the responsibility of the landlord, it is yours.  If there is a fire, your property can be reduced to smoke and no one is legally responsible to pay you for the loss.  These are the reasons it just makes good sense to have a renter’s policy ]]></description>
